: Unlike the standard FCP inspector, Color Finale Pro uses a layer-based approach. This allows editors to stack color corrections, masks, and LUTs (Look-Up Tables) in a non-destructive manner, making it easier to manage complex grades.
While Final Cut Pro has improved its native color tools over the years, many professional editors still prefer Color Finale 2 because it centralizes all tools into a single, intuitive interface. It eliminates the need to jump between different inspectors or use multiple plugins for basic grading tasks. Color Finale Pro 2.2.8

: One of the standout features is the ability to apply a "Group" grade. Instead of copying and pasting effects between clips individually, you can group clips and adjust the color of the entire scene simultaneously, ensuring visual consistency across a project.
